Taking the lead in recognising the needs of Singaporeans
 
One in seven Singaporeans experienced a mental disorder in their lifetime5, compared to one in eight in 2010, with Major Depressive Disorder (MDD) and Obsessive Compulsive Disorder (OCD) amongst the top mental conditions that people are seeking help for.
 
To encourage timely and appropriate treatments of mental health conditions, AIA Beyond Critical Care provides coverage for five mental illnesses6, namely, Major Depressive Disorders (MDD), Schizophrenia, Bipolar Disorder, Obsessive Compulsive Disorder (OCD), and Tourette Syndrome.
 
Majority of people in Singapore, approximately 75 per cent, with a mental disorder in their lifetime, did not seek any professional help, according to the second Singapore Mental Health Study conducted in 2016 by the Institute of Mental Health (IMH) and Nanyang Technological University (NTU)7.
 
Allaying concerns and providing additional peace of mind for Singaporeans
 
In addition to providing coverage for 43 major stage CIs, AIA Beyond Critical Care is also the first-in-market to cover five rediagnosed or recurred CIs – which includes major cancer, stroke, heart attack, heart valve surgery, and major organ / bone marrow transplantation - providing up to 200 per cent of the Insured Amount for the CI benefit.
 
A top concern among many CI survivors is the recurrence of a CI, especially for cancer, which is most likely to relapse in the first five years after treatment ends8, according to several studies. This is further supported by the AIA Critical Illness Study 2018 findings, which revealed that approximately 7 in 10 Singaporeans find recurring CI coverage important and more than half are willing to pay a higher premium for recurring CI coverage.

About AIA
 
AIA Group Limited and its subsidiaries (collectively "AIA" or the "Group") comprise the largest independent publicly listed pan-Asian life insurance group. It has a presence in 18 markets in Asia-Pacific – wholly-owned branches and subsidiaries in Hong Kong, Thailand, Singapore, Malaysia, China, Korea, the Philippines, Australia, Indonesia, Taiwan, Vietnam, New Zealand, Macau, Brunei, Cambodia, a 97 per cent subsidiary in Sri Lanka, a 49 per cent joint venture in India and a representative office in Myanmar.
 
The business that is now AIA was first established in Shanghai almost a century ago in 1919. It is a market leader in the Asia-Pacific region (ex-Japan) based on life insurance premiums and holds leading positions across the majority of its markets. It had total assets of US$221 billion as of 30 June 2018.
 
AIA meets the long-term savings and protection needs of individuals by offering a range of products and services including life insurance, accident and health insurance and savings plans. The Group also provides employee benefits, credit life and pension services to corporate clients. Through an extensive network of agents, partners and employees across Asia-Pacific, AIA serves the holders of 32 million individual policies and over 16 million participating members of group insurance schemes.
 
AIA Group Limited is listed on the Main Board of The Stock Exchange of Hong Kong Limited under the stock code "1299" with American Depositary Receipts (Level 1) traded on the over-the-counter market (ticker symbol: "AAGIY").
